What recent guests emphasize

Comfortable oceanfront suites with attentive service

Guests highlight spacious, well-maintained rooms with stunning ocean views and convenient beach access. The hotel offers a secure and family-friendly environment, supported by friendly and helpful staff. Some operational issues have been noted but are generally addressed promptly.

Guests often praise

  • Spacious suites featuring full kitchens and in-unit laundry facilities.
  • Beautiful ocean views and direct beach access steps from the property.
  • Friendly, attentive, and helpful staff members who enhance the guest experience.
  • Well-maintained pools including indoor and outdoor options, plus hot tubs and fitness facilities.
  • Secure private parking with key access and visible security presence.

Worth knowing

  • Housekeeping service may not be provided during shorter stays or timeshare bookings.
  • Elevator outages have caused delays and inconvenience during busy check-out times.
  • Some guests reported isolated cleanliness issues, including dirty floors and a pest sighting.
  • Breakfast, parking, and Wi-Fi are available for an additional fee.
  • On-site Starbucks staff received mixed feedback, especially regarding child-friendliness.

Best for

  • Families seeking spacious accommodations with kid-friendly amenities and beach proximity.
  • Visitors looking for a peaceful, secure stay with direct ocean views.
  • Travelers who appreciate on-site dining, recreational facilities, and bars.
  • Guests interested in a quiet, off-season retreat with full resort amenities.
  • Groups or large parties who benefit from multi-bedroom condo suites and kitchen facilities.

About this property

Welcome to Hilton Grand Vacations Club Ocean 22 Myrtle Beach

Hilton Grand Vacations Club Ocean 22 Myrtle Beach is a contemporary all-suite hotel situated directly on the beachfront at 2200 N Ocean Blvd. This 4.5-star property offers spacious accommodations with ocean views, including kitchens in all rooms, making it suitable for families and longer stays. Facilities include both indoor and outdoor pools, a hot tub, fitness center, and several on-site bars and a restaurant, catering to a variety of guest needs.

The location is convenient for visitors looking to explore Myrtle Beach on foot. The hotel is a 10-minute walk from the Myrtle Beach Convention Center and about 13 minutes from the popular bars, restaurants, and shops along the Myrtle Beach Boardwalk. Nearby attractions such as Broadway at the Beach, SkyWheel Myrtle Beach, and Ripley's Aquarium are also easily accessible, offering entertainment options for all ages.

Guest reviews highlight the spaciousness and cleanliness of the suites, as well as attentive staff and secure parking facilities. Some feedback notes occasional issues such as elevator outages and housekeeping policies, which have been addressed promptly by management. Overall, the property is appreciated for its family-friendly amenities and beachfront convenience, although pricing can be higher during peak seasons.

While the hotel does not offer airport shuttle services, Myrtle Beach International Airport is just a 12-minute drive away, enhancing accessibility for travelers. The presence of a business center and accessible facilities adds practical value for various types of guests. This property is generally recommended for visitors seeking a quiet, well-equipped base with easy beach access and proximity to local attractions.
